Modern Cloud Has Seven Layers, Not Three — Here's What Actually Changed

The traditional three-tier cloud model of IaaS, PaaS, and SaaS no longer reflects how modern infrastructure actually works, with the stack having expanded to seven distinct levels over the past 18 months. The boundary between 'warm' always-on servers and 'cold' serverless functions has blurred, as platforms like Vercel and Google Cloud Run now offer hybrid billing models that combine traits of both. The term 'serverless' has also fragmented into at least four distinct categories — functions, containers, edge isolates, and serverless databases — each with very different constraints and limits. Meanwhile, significant capital has shifted toward the database layer, highlighted by Databricks acquiring serverless Postgres startup Neon for approximately $1 billion despite the company generating around $25 million in revenue. A new infrastructure layer has also emerged to support AI agents that autonomously write and execute code, signaling a fundamental reshaping of how cloud computing is structured and taught.
